State minister calls for action on alleged Pakistan links in Sambhajinagar
A Maharashtra minister has raised concerns about external influence in the city and demanded a security response.
A Maharashtra minister has alleged links to Pakistan within Chhatrapati Sambhajinagar and sought urgent action against them. The minister's statement underscores growing concerns about external influence in the region.
Details of the specific allegations and the minister's proposed measures remain unclear from initial reports. The statement is likely to prompt further scrutiny and discussion around security protocols in the city.
